Blackeyed Theatre Announces Two-Month Tour of FRANKENSTEIN
by Chloe Rabinowitz
- Dec 16, 2021
Blackeyed Theatre have today announced their acclaimed production of Frankenstein will be coming back to the stage in January for a two-month tour. Adapted by Nick Lane from John Ginman's original 2016 adaptation, Frankenstein will open in Bracknell on 27 January, touring to theatres across England until 29 March.

Scarborough's Stephen Joseph Theatre Presents Film of THE SNOW QUEEN
by Stephi Wild
- Dec 22, 2020
A brand new film of the Scarborough theatre's sell-out Christmas show, The Snow Queen, will be available on the SJT website from noon on Wednesday 23 December 2020 until midnight on Sunday 31 January 2021. It's the first time the famous North Yorkshire theatre has ventured into filming its productions.

2020 Dates Announced For JANE EYRE International Tour
by Stephi Wild
- Dec 13, 2019
Six months of 2020 touring dates have been announced for Blackeyed Theatre's epic international tour of Nick Lane's thrilling new adaptation of Charlotte Brontë's masterpiece Jane Eyre. This spectacular world premiere is touring until June 2020, and will make its way across the UK, including a return home to the Yorkshire moors, as well as The Netherlands and China.
